72nd District Court in Marine City Unveils Security Improvements

The 72nd District Court in Marine City is unveiling some major changes to the public this week after a remodel to enhance court security. The project began in early 2019, and was completed in August. The largest part of the project was a security wing to house in-custody defendants with two holding cells and two attorney/client meeting rooms. Cameras were installed on the interior and exterior of the building, as well as a new key card system for non-public areas. 

The main entrance was revamped adding a security station. The Prosecutor’s office and Victims Rights office were relocated to allow for more privacy. Nearly $250,000 was approved for the project, and when finished, it came in under budget by nearly $8000. William Vogan and Associates was the architectural firm, and LaBelle Construction served as the general contractor.
